Note: If you have a fearful dog training is very different and I recommend you focus on only the fearful dog for training.
-
This one is harder to answer. While I am happy to have family participate in sessions the actual training is best done by one person initially. What I recommend is one family member begin the training to allow the dog to learn, cause learning is hard, then about two weeks later the rest of the family can participate in the actual training of the dog.

At the end of each session I will suggest skills you and your dog can work on for the coming week. If you work with your dog a few times each day for about 10 minutes each training session that will be enough for you and your dog to be successful. More often each day is always good too but much longer is not always better. During the course I do not limit you or your dog to a set of specific skills, the better you and your dog do the more advanced skills I can teach you during the eight weeks. Training is meant to be fun for both of you.
